=====================  Hazards Identification  =====================

Effects of Overexposure:IRRITATING TO SKIN AND EYES.VAPORS AND FUMES
    IRRITATE RESPIRATORY TRACT.SKIN MAY BECOME SENSITIE.

=======================  First Aid Measures  =======================

First Aid:INHALE:REMOVE TO FRESH AIR, GIVE CPR/O*2 IF
    NEED;EYES/SKIN:FLUSH W LG AMTS H*2O FOR 15 MIN;INGEST:RINSE MOUTH;
    GET MEDICAL ATTENTION FOR EYES, BREATHING DIFFICULTY, OR OTHER
    SYMPTOMS OF OVEREXPOSURE.

=====================  Fire Fighting Measures  =====================

Flash Point:160F TAG.C.CUP
Extinguishing Media:CO*2,WATER FOG,FOAM,DRY CHEMICAL
Fire Fighting Procedures:USE FULL PROTECTIVE EQUIPMENT WITH SCBA.
Unusual Fire/Explosion Hazard:IN CLOSED CONTAINERS CONTAIG
    LIQUID,PRESSURE BUILD-UP DUE TO HEAT EXPOSURE.WATER MAY BE
    USEDTOCOOL

==================  Accidental Release Measures  ==================

Spill Release Procedures:CLEAN UP AND PUT BACK IN CONTAINER.COVER WITH
    LAYER OF SAND AND SCRAPE UP. USE FULL PROTECTIVE CLOTHING WITH
    SCBA. DO NOT ALLOW TO GET INTO STREAM.

======================	Handling and Storage  ======================

Handling and Storage Precautions:COMBUSTIBLE LIQUID,STORE
    INCLOSED,PROPERLY LABELED CONTAINERS IN COOL PLACE.KEEP AWAY HIGH
    TEMPERATURE AREAS,SPARKS,FIRE,OPEN FLAMES.
Other Precautions:DO NOT TAKE INTERNALLY.AVOID PROLONGED AND/OR REPEAT
    BREATHING OF MIST,VAPORS.AVOID CONTACT WITH SKIN,EYES,AND CLOTHING
    PROVIDE ADEQUATE VENTILATION.KEEP OUT OF THE REACH OF CHILDREN.

=============  Exposure Controls/Personal Protection  =============

Respiratory Protection:IF EXPOSD TLV,NIOSH/MESA APPR SELF-CNTND BRTHG
    APP (POS PR MODE)
Ventilation:LOCAL EXHAUST TO MAINTN BELOW TLV.
Protective Gloves:NEOPRENE
Eye Protection:GOGGLES/FACE SHIELD
Other Protective Equipment:EYE WASH STATION. APRONS. SPECIAL IMPERVIOUS
    CLOTHING.

==================  Physical/Chemical Properties  ==================

HCC:T4
Boiling Pt:B.P. Text:+356F/180C
Vapor Pres:1.0
Vapor Density:>1.0
Spec Gravity:1.050
Evaporation Rate & Reference:SLOW
Solubility in Water:SLIGHT
Appearance and Odor:YELLOWISH TO DARK GREEN-BROWN,OILY LIQUID

=================  Stability and Reactivity Data  =================

Stability Indicator/Materials to Avoid:YES
Stability Condition to Avoid:AVOID OVER HEATING
Hazardous Decomposition Products:NONE
